Semiexclusive production of $J/ψ$ mesons in proton-proton collisions with electromagnetic and diffractive dissociation of one of the protons
Abstract
We calculate the cross sections for both electromagnetic and diffractive dissociation of protons for semiexclusive production of $J/ψ$ mesons in proton-proton collisions at the LHC. Several differential distributions in missing mass ($M_X$), or single-particle variables related exclusively to the $J/ψ$ meson are calculated for $\sqrt{s}$ = 7 TeV as an example. The cross sections and distributions are compared to the cross section of the purely exclusive reaction $p p \to p p J/ψ$. We show the corresponding ratio as a function of $J/ψ$ meson rapidity. We compare the distributions for purely electromagnetic and purely diffractive proton excitations/dissociation. We predict cross sections for electromagnetic and diffractive excitations of similar order of magnitude.
